WILLMAR, Minn. – A teenager is in jail after authorities say he was driving under the influence early Sunday morning before a head-on crash that killed the other driver in central Minnesota.
The Minnesota State Patrol says the crash happened on Highway 71, twelve miles north of Willmar. Investigators say a pickup and a car were traveling in opposite directions on the highway when they collided.
The crash killed the driver of the car, a 52-year-old Willmar woman. A passenger in her car, a 31-year-old Belgrade man, was injured but is expected to survive.
The driver of the truck, an 18-year-old Willmar man, was also hurt in the crash and transported to a hospital for treatment and later he was booked into the Kandiyohi County Jail, pending charges of criminal vehicular homicide.
